Bioactive glasses promote rapid pre-osteoblastic cell migration in contrast to hydroxyapatite, while carbonated apatite shows migration inhibiting properties

Abstract Different biomaterials have been clinically used as bone filling materials, although the mechanisms behind the biological effects are incompletely understood.
